Steps to find the percentage of a number

Method 1: Using Proportions

Let's find 35% of 501 using proportion.

35% is 35 out of 100.

\[ \frac{ 35 }{100} \]

Write the proportion to find x out of 501.

\[ \frac{ 35 }{100} = \frac{x}{ 501 } \]

Cross-multiply: 35 × 501 = 100x

\[ 35 \cdot 501 = 100x \]

Solve for x: (35 × 501) ÷ 100 = x

\[ \frac{ 17535 }{100} = x \]

Hence, 35% of 501 is 175.35.

Method 2: Keyword-Based

Use keywords: "of" means multiply.

Convert 35% to decimal: 0.35

\[ x = 501 \cdot 0.35 \]

Multiply 501 × 0.35 = 175.35

So, 35% of 501 is 175.35.
